Delaware County, Pa. (YC) – An 8-year-old child was struck by train in Tinicum Township in Delaware County.

This is a developing story. 

Update – 6:09 p.m.

47-7b & 100D enroute to CCMC, trains shutdown. 

Update – 5:58 p.m.

- Advertisement -

Fire department dispatched to extricate subject of area, requiring stokes basket & backboard.

Update – 5:51 p.m.

Police on location w/8 y/o juvenile w/full amputation of leg, requesting medics to expedite. EMS enroute.
